Understanding Australian eSports Bonuses: How They Work

Australian eSports bonuses

Australian eSports bonuses have emerged as a significant aspect of the thriving gaming industry down under. These incentives, designed to enhance player engagement and foster competitive spirit, come in various forms such as sign-up rewards, in-game promotions, and tournament prizes. Understanding how these bonuses work is crucial for both players and developers aiming to capitalize on the growing eSports market.

One common feature of Australian eSports bonuses is their tie-in with popular gaming platforms and titles. For instance, many mobile-friendly eSports apps offer initial bonus credits or free items upon downloading and creating an account. Subsequently, players can earn additional rewards through regular gameplay, achieving specific milestones, or participating in daily challenges. This gamification approach not only encourages active engagement but also builds a loyal player base. Data from recent studies indicates that nearly 70% of Australian gamers actively seek out eSports-related bonuses, highlighting their growing importance in the local gaming culture.

Moreover, Australian eSports bonuses often serve as a strategic marketing tool for app developers. By offering generous rewards, apps can attract new users and retain existing ones, fostering a competitive environment that drives continuous improvement. For players, these bonuses provide tangible benefits, from enhancing their in-game capabilities to unlocking exclusive content. However, it’s essential to approach these incentives with a critical eye. Players should review the terms and conditions associated with bonuses to understand any playthrough requirements or restrictions on redemption.

Evaluating App Features for Optimal Gaming Experience

Australian eSports bonuses

When evaluating mobile-friendly eSports apps with bonuses for Australian players, focusing on app features is paramount to securing an optimal gaming experience. Key considerations include intuitive navigation, seamless graphics rendering, and responsive controls designed for smaller screens. For instance, top-tier apps like League of Legends: Wild Rift and Call of Duty: Mobile excel in these areas, offering smooth gameplay that rivals their desktop counterparts.

Moreover, bonus systems should be structured to encourage engagement without hindering progress. Australian eSports bonuses that provide in-game currency, cosmetic items, or experience boosts can significantly enhance player investment and satisfaction. However, it’s crucial for developers to balance these incentives; excessive bonuses may dilute the overall gaming experience if they introduce unnecessary distractions or economic imbalances within the game. For example, Fortnite effectively uses daily and weekly challenges coupled with in-game rewards to keep players engaged without overwhelming them.

Another vital aspect is cross-platform compatibility and social integration. Players increasingly access eSports apps on multiple devices, so ensuring a consistent experience across platforms is essential. Additionally, integrating social features like clan systems, chat functionality, or leaderboards fosters a sense of community, which is a significant driver of user retention. Apps that seamlessly merge these elements—as seen in Clash Royale and PUBG Mobile—typically enjoy higher user satisfaction rates and prolonged engagement.
